Subject: Pop-up office at the Veltrane Trade Fair — reception notes

Hi all,

Our pop-up office at the Veltrane Fair opens Wednesday in Hall 4. Reception staff rotating through should report to the hall steward desk first, then set up the welcome counter by 08:30. The pop-up unit's rear storage door is keypad-locked. For the duration of the fair, use the code below.

staff pass of kawip-hawef = bdg-QLP-2

TURN-208: Gatevale turnstile counters at the Merrow Field pilot double-count when a rotation reverses mid-cycle. Attendance totals drift roughly 2% high per event. The debounce window fix is implemented, reviewed by Ilsa, and soak-tested across two simulated match days without drift. Ready for your cut; the candidate build is identified below.

trace token, tagag-tafog: htk6_5ed18c

- [ ] Step 7: Archive cold storage buckets (Glacierline tier). Confirm both ceremony witnesses are present, verify bucket manifests match the Oxbow ledger, then seal the archive key shares. Plugin authors may observe but not handle shares. Once sealed, the archive index itself is encrypted and can only be reopened with the passphrase below.

vault phrase of badup-hahig = tamael-aldael-kelmir-istael-fenok-istwyn-tamius-jorath-oliion